Cambian Group Plc is seeking a Residential Children’s Team Leader in Widnes. You'll support young people, helping with daily routines, creating a homely environment, and joining them in fun activities. No prior experience is required, as we provide full training. You'll build meaningful relationships and play a vital part in their development.

The position offers various benefits, including health discounts and career growth opportunities. Join us to make a difference!

How to prepare for a job interview at Cambian Group Plc

Know the Role Inside Out

Before your interview, make sure you understand what being a Residential Children’s Team Leader involves. Familiarise yourself with the daily routines and activities you’ll be supporting. This will help you demonstrate your enthusiasm and readiness to create a homely environment for the young people.

Show Your Passion for Making a Difference

During the interview, express your genuine interest in helping young people develop. Share any relevant experiences, even if they’re not directly related to this role. Whether it’s volunteering or simply spending time with kids, showing that you care can set you apart from other candidates.

Prepare Questions to Ask

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the team dynamics, training opportunities, and how success is measured in the role. This shows that you’re not just interested in the job, but also in how you can grow and contribute to the Cambian Group.

Be Yourself and Build Rapport

Remember, the interviewers want to see the real you! Be authentic and let your personality shine through. Building rapport with the interviewers can make a huge difference, so don’t hesitate to share a bit about yourself and why you’re excited about this opportunity.
